Since now you are graduate, you can pursue only a 3 year law course. The various entrance exams that you can give are DU LL.B. BHU LL.B. AMU and JMI LL.B. Further, CCSU also has a 3 year law course. You can also do 3yr law from private universities. It would be best to crack DU entrance exam for which you should try solving the previous years, coaching is not necessary for the entrance exams.

As such law entrance exam does not need any coaching if you are good at general knowledge, logical reasoning and English. Nevertheless, if you want to prepare for NLUs, then Mukherjee Nagar, Delhi is full of coaching institutes. Please enquire there. All coaching institutes are same. It totally depends upon your hard work and perseverance
